Editing Process:
We edit the video effects in AE based on the reference video.
We first shot two shots, one was an empty shot and the other was a character
entering the shot. Then, I used the Roto brush in AE to cut out the
character.
Fig 1.1 Character cutting process
Then I imported the empty shot. In order to reflect the feeling of the
character passing through the wall, I first cut out the arm according to the
dynamics, then added a mask, drew a circle with the pen tool, and used the
mask path to follow the movement of the arm to create a visual effect of the
arm passing through first.
Fig 1.3 Arm effects
Next, I created a new mask and adjusted the body parts. According to the
video, I started with the legs, then the body and finally the head, and made
detailed adjustments in the mask and timeline.
Fig 1.4 Process Production
Finally, I adjusted the timeline of each segment to make the video connection
smoother.
In creating the special effect of time suddenly stopping, we continued to use
AE software. In order to show that time suddenly stopped, we first added slow
motion at the moment before stopping to extend the time.
Fig 1.5 Time extension
Then I added freeze frames when the phone falls to complete the feeling of
time standing still.
Color grading and atmosphere rendering:
We added the special effects video to Premiere Pro and continued editing and
storytelling.
After completing the video production, we performed color correction.
Because the original video would become exposed after being imported into
the computer, we made many adjustments in color correction to make the video
no longer exposed.
Fig 2.1 Color Correction
In terms of color grading, I used more dark brown in the first half to give
people a feeling of being suppressed. After awakening in the second half, I
adjusted the saturation to make the colors brighter, creating a contrast
before and after, reflecting the release of the character's stress.
Fig 2.2 Preliminary color grading
Fig 2.3 Post-production color grading
After completing the color correction and color grading of the video, we
started to add music and sound effects. We divided the work and cooperated.
Shi Manlin searched for music and audio on Pixabay, and then we added
Premiere Pro to edit and align the audio.
I completed my dubbing. In order to reflect the mysterious feeling of my
character, I added reverb to the sound editing to make the sound more
ethereal.
Fig 3.1 Sound Shaping

Observation: During the video editing process, I gradually
realized that color correction and color grading play a very critical
role in the entire visual narrative. Color is not only a decorative
element of the picture, but also an important medium for conveying
emotions. By fine-tuning the parameters such as the brightness and
contrast of the picture, I can ensure the uniformity of the material on
the technical level, which is the basic task of color correction. In the
color grading process, I used a dark brown tone on the picture in the
early stage of the story to reduce the saturation and express the
feeling of loneliness and depression.
Color correction and color grading are not just "beautification" tools
in the later stage, but an important narrative language to help tell the
story. I tried a lot in this practice.
